December Home Sales Second Highest on Record
2009 – In Like a Lamb, Out Like a Lion
Vancouver, BC – January 12, 2010. The British Columbia Real Estate Association (BCREA) reports that Multiple Listing Service® (MLS®) residential sales in the province climbed 132 per cent to 5,703 units in December compared to the same month last year. More homes were sold last month than in any December on record except 1989 when 6,014 units were sold.
A total of 85,028 residential units were sold through the MLS® in 2009, up 23 per cent from 68,923 units in 2008. The residential sales dollar volume increased 26 per cent to $39.6 billion last year, while the average MLS® residential price increased 2 per cent to $465,725.
"Considerable momentum in the housing market is expected to carry through the first quarter of 2010, before home sales begin to moderate as a result of eroding affordability and less pent-up demand,” added Muir.
